Gain insights into the exciting world of quality assurance in the gaming industry.Games testers work can be cyclical. It is not uncommon for developers to base their release schedules – and temporarily heightened need for games testers – around industry events like the annual GDC (Game Developers Conference), console release cycles, and holiday consumer demand. A game tester sits testing new games locating bugs and flaws before the game is put out to the market end users. Game testers enable customers with the possibility to play a highly developed product that meets their expectations on its design, compatibility and functioning. ...Playing a game, or single level of a game, performing hundreds of different scenarios to test for any bugs or glitches. Investigating any bugs which have previously been reported. Writing up specific details on each bug, so they can be looked at in greater detail. Consider obtaining a …A couple other random tips: Spellcheck your resume/application/cover letter/etc. and make sure all the information (phone number, email address, etc.) is up to date. When applying for a job where the primary requirement is attention to detail, mistakes in your application stand out to the people looking to hire you.Oct 5, 2019 · Having the right set of defined skills will make a great QA tester that has a real impact on the project. That way, our team knows to email you whenever a Centercode gaming client is recruiting testers for their ...May 19, 2023 · Press various buttons at several locations continuously. Make sure to retrace your steps before completing the level to compare the results. Examine the consequences as well of trying to walk through objects, such as a wall. Perform functionality tests. Test the menu and its functions to ensure they are operational. Mar 25, 2021 ... The requirements for the game tester jobs can vary based on the company you are applying for. Skilled game testers who work full-time for large game development firms …As a game tester, you work with developers to ensure the game meets the community’s expectations. There are two types of testers: a quality assurance technician (QA) and a playtester. A QA technician is what most people imagine when they think of game testers.
